Treated by Peter's to a 61Rc; contoured handle made out of white Corian, blue/gray acrilester and blue g10 liners, secured with G-Flex epoxy and stainless pins. The full flat ground blade finish was done by hand and is not completely even, but does not affect performance. 0.11" stock, 7" blade, 12" overall length, $150 shipped USPS priority in the US/HI/PR
